Ye Olde King's Head Hotel, Chester
Historic Tudor inn in Chester famed for its rich heritage, cozy charm, and legendary paranormal activity.
Ye Olde King's Head Hotel in Chester is a historic Tudor-style inn dating back to 1622, built on 13th-century foundations. Renowned for its timber-framed façade, antique interiors, and rich history, it offers cozy accommodation and a traditional pub atmosphere. The hotel is famed for its paranormal activity, hosting up to 13 reported spirits, making it a unique destination for history enthusiasts and ghost hunters alike.

A Living Legacy from Medieval Chester
Ye Olde King's Head Hotel stands proudly on Lower Bridge Street, Chester, embodying over 800 years of history. Originally constructed around 1208 as the townhouse for Peter the Clerk, the administrator of Chester Castle, its foundations reach deep into medieval times. The present Tudor-style timber-framed building dates from 1622, showcasing classic Stuart period architecture with its distinctive jettied upper storey. The structure also incorporates parts of the iconic Chester Rows—medieval covered walkways—visible today through the support pillars on the middle floor. This blend of medieval and Tudor elements makes the building a remarkable architectural and historical treasure.From Grand Residence to Historic Inn
By the early 18th century, the building transitioned into an inn, welcoming weary travellers, merchants, and locals. Known as The King’s Head from 1717, it became a vital social hub within Chester’s city centre. Over centuries, it has preserved its old-world charm with exposed wooden beams, Elizabethan fireplaces, and antique furnishings. Restorations in the 20th century carefully maintained its Tudor character, while archaeological finds during these works—such as a hidden sword and timbers reputedly from Admiral Lord Nelson’s ship—add layers of intrigue to its story.The Haunted Heart of Chester
Ye Olde King's Head is widely regarded as one of the UK's most haunted hotels. Reports of paranormal activity have persisted for decades, with up to 13 spirits said to inhabit the building. Notable hauntings include a man in black seen in Room 6 and the apparition of a child in Room 4, where unexplained noises, moved objects, and eerie laughter are frequently reported. The upper floors have been transformed into "My Haunted Hotel," equipped with 24/7 night-vision and thermal cameras capturing supernatural phenomena. This reputation attracts ghost hunters and paranormal enthusiasts, making the hotel a unique blend of hospitality and mystery.A Cozy Hub for Visitors and Locals

Designated a Grade II* listed building, Ye Olde King's Head is protected for its architectural and cultural importance. Its preservation ensures that future generations can experience this unique fusion of medieval roots, Tudor elegance, and paranormal intrigue.
